About

Deanna Taylor uses food and storytelling integrated into the world of arts, science, and entrepreneurship to blend generations while resurrecting the art of canning. During the pandemic, while watching squirrels in her backyard take one bite out of her fruit, she was inspired to research ways to keep the food from going to waste. Since then, Deanna has been producing jams, jellies, and preserves with the help of her family. 

Throughout her journey, Deanna begun using “the jars of preserves to coach others into entrepreneurship while focusing on preserving their peace.” Along with her family, she now gets help from neighbors, church members, and other figures within her community, preventing as much fruit as they can from going to waste. At the end of the process, Deanna utilizes the preserves for storytelling, gives back to those who donated, and even makes a profit.
